Default Long awaited upgrade to office Vintage system....

Greetings gang.... today is a very enjoyable day for me as I am enjoying an upgrade completed last evening to my vintage office system that has been on my mind for many years.


This system is based on the system that was once my main system, going back to the mid seventies. The system is based on a Crown IC150A preamp, and a Crown DC300 amplifier. Back in 1977, this young audiophile had upgraded the IC150 preamp that was originally in the system with the redesigned IC150A preamp. At that time, the price of the redesigned DC300A amplifier was simply out of reach for me. That system now includes my McIntosh MR78 Tuner, a Soundcraftsmen RP2212 equalizer, and a Carver CD player. The speakers for this office system are JBL 4401 near field monitors, located near the ceiling in the corners of the room. There is also a JBL PB10 powered sub, which is necessary as the 4401 somply cannot produce a satisfactory low end with their 6-1/2" woofers.

One week ago, in my periodic scouring of eBay, I came across the one component that I had long felt was needed to really make this system "right". I had resisted in the past making any move, but this time around I decided to bid in the auction since the condition of the piece in question appeared to be about as pristine as one could possibly hope for.

I won the auction for an incredibly reasonable price, having seen many examples of this same component in much lesser condition sell for more than the price I ended up paying.

Default Impressions

As soon as I turned on the amplifier, I could tell that this amplifier is superior to its predecessor. Better bass control, a smoother and more revealing sound was apparent from the start. It was nearly 1am by the time I forced myself to turn it off last night.

The amplifier came with the manual, proof of performance report, and even included 5 of the yellow Crown stickers they used to include with their new products. I've had one of these on my IC150A's front panel overlay for years. I probably won't put one on the DC300A, but I didn't mind getting a new supply.








Is this amplifier the equal of some of today's monster amps? No, but it is a very special piece to me, and a classic piece of audio history. Its construction is absolutely first-rate, right up there with my McIntosh amps, IMO. It may not have the same allure as those big blue meters do, but it is certainly very attractive, its appearance is understated but in a very elegant but no-nonsense way. I really love the way it matches the cosmetics of my IC150A preamp so perfectly. First class.
